Drake has released the video for “ Another Late Night ,” featuring Lil Yachty from his new album For All The Dogs .
The Cole Bennett-directed video premiered through Lyrical Lemonade on Friday (Oct. 6), where Drizzy and Lil Boat rap under an array of lights, surrounded by wolves.
Drake raps, “My bank account is magnolia, Milly rockin’, ayy/ Weirdos in my comments talkin’ ’bout some Millie Bobby, look/ Bring them jokes up to the gang, we get to really flockin’/ Or send a finger to your mama in some FedEx boxes/ Open up that sh*t, it’s jaw droppin’, really shockin’, ayy/ I ain’t pretty flacko, bi**h, this sh*t get really rocky, ayy, what?”
He also plays on A$AP Rocky’s name .
Yachty then comes in with, “It’s Lil Boat, I’m practically now from the 6ix/ My doggy Luxxy ignorant, he from the bricks/ Thinkin’ ’bout this styro cup, really Wockin’/ Let her f**k on one my opps, let’s see who really poppin’.”
Both rappers sport interesting looks as Yachty wears a mouth full of gold, and Drake dons colorful flower barrettes in his hair. See the video above.
Drake recently showed love to the “Poland” rapper during his Field Trip Tour.
Taking the mic, the “Slime You Out” rapper told Yachty’s fans, “First of all, I just wanna say, y’all make some noise for one of my best friends in the muthaf**kin’ world. You been going crazy tonight. I haven’t been home in four months, so you take yourself a little break. I’ma try some sh*t out.” Drake then proceeded to perform “Meltdown,” a collaborative song from Travis Scott‘s UTOPIA .
“Me and him are kind of different when it comes to lifestyle,” Yachty recently told Complex . “We’re really similar as people, but as far as life, we’re very different. I don’t go out, he loves to go out, he loves to host people, he loves to party and I don’t like people that much.”
“I record every day all day, where he kind of is very selective on his recording days as he has more of a life than I do,” he added. “And, he is much more into actually living life as to where I am literally trying to record music every day.”

Watch Drake’s New Music Video for “Another Late Night” Featuring Lil Yachty
by Matt Friedlander October 9, 2023, 1:34 pm
Coinciding with this past Friday’s release of his latest studio album, For All the Dogs , Drake has premiered a new music video for one of the record’s 23 tracks, “Another Late Night,” a collaboration with Lil Yachty.
Videos by American Songwriter
The clip, which was directed by award-winning video director Cole Bennett, features scenes of Drake on a surreal late-night ride in a sports car bedazzled with Christmas lights driven by social media personality Pisceus.
[RELATED: Drake’s Son Adonis Makes Rap Debut on For All the Dogs]
Also in the video, Drake and Yachty are seen rapping in a dirt-covered parking lot illuminated by stars that look like Christmas lights and sometimes accompanied by snarling wolves. In another scene, Lil Yachty is getting a new neck tattoo. The video ends with Pisceus driving Drake in their lit-up car over a bridge that’s also covered in Christmas lights.
“Another Late Night” has been getting some online attention for one of its verses in which Drake appears to address criticism of his friendship with teenage Stranger Things star Millie Bobby Brown , who commented during a 2018 red-carpet interview — when she was 14 — that Drake was “a great friend and a great role model” and revealed that they frequently texted each other.
Drake raps in the track: My bank account is magnolia, Milly rockin’ / Weirdos in my comments talkin’ ‘bout some Millie Bobby / Bring them jokes up to the gang, we get to really flockin’.
For All the Dogs also featured the chart-topping hit “Slime You Out,” featuring SZA, and new single “8AM in Charlotte.” A video for the latter track premiered just in advance of the album’s release, and featured Drake’s five-year-old son, Adonis Graham, talking to his dad a bout a drawing he did, part of which was used as the cover art for the record.
Adonis, who turns 6 on Wednesday, also is heard rapping at the end of the For All the Dogs track “Daylight.” The album also features guest appearances by 21 Savage, J. Cole, PARTYNEXTDOOR, Chief Keef, Bad Bunny, and more.

Drake and Lil Yachty Rap With Wolves in New Video for “Another Late Night”: Watch
Drake has shared a music video for his For All the Dogs song “Another Late Night” with Lil Yachty . Directed by Cole Bennett and filmed over the course of two hours, the visual finds both of the musicians rapping with wolves, dancing in a parking lot, and riding in a Christmas lights-wrapped sports car with a young woman in furry ears. Drake also eagerly holds up a box of McNuggets. Watch it below.
“Another Late Night” is the second song from Drake’s new album to get a music video, following the “ 8am in Charlotte ” clip starring Adonis Graham, his son. (Adonis also drew the album artwork for For All the Dogs .) Ahead of the album’s release, Drake dropped the SZA-featuring “ Slime You Out .” Other guests on For All the Dogs include Bad Bunny, J. Cole, Sexyy Red, Chief Keef, 21 Savage, Teezo Touchdown, Yeat, and PartyNextDoor.
For All the Dogs boasts a few notable samples, too, ranging from Frank Ocean’s “Wiseman” on “Virginia Beach” and Chief Keef’s “I Don’t Like” on “7969 Santa” to the controversial interpolation of Pet Shop Boys’ “West End Girls” on “All the Parties,” which Pet Shop Boys claimed Drake used with “no credit given or permission requested.”
Drake is still in the midst of his It’s All a Blur Tour in support of his joint album with 21 Savage, Her Loss . It was one of two LPs he released in 2022, following Honestly, Nevermind .

Drake shares surreal new video for ‘Another Late Night’
Lil Yachty also features in the video
Drake has shared a music video for his new song, ‘Another Late Night’ with Lil Yachty . Check out the video below.
Directed by Cole Bennett, the surreal visual finds both Drake and Lil Yachty rapping with wolves. The video was filmed over the course of two hours.
The song is the second from Drake’s new album, ‘ For All The Dogs ‘, which followed on from ‘ 8am in Charlotte ‘, which featured his son. The new album includes the SZA collaboration ‘Slime You Out’ along with features from 21 Savage , J. Cole , Bad Bunny and more.
You can watch the new vide here:
Soon after the release of the album this week, Drake – real name Aubrey Drake Graham – announced that he’ll be stepping back from music for the time being.
“I probably won’t make music for a little bit, I’m gonna be honest,” he said on his SiriusXM radio show Table For One today (via BBC ).
Recommended
A number of shows have also been postponed on his ‘It’s All A Blur’ tour following his announcement, including dates in Denver, New Orleans, Nashville and Columbus, Ohio.
“I need to focus on my health, first and foremost – and I’ll talk about that soon enough,” he added. “Nothing crazy, but just like, you know, I want people to be healthy in life, and I’ve been having the craziest problems for years with my stomach.
“I’m going to lock the door on the studio for a little bit,” he said. “I don’t even know what a little bit is. Maybe a year or something. Maybe a little longer.”
The rapper’s new album was initially set for release on September 22 , but was pushed back so that he could have more time to finish the record while still on tour .
His most recent solo album before this was last year’s ‘ Honestly, Nevermind’ , which NME said in a three-star review “surprises in many ways, ditching bland trap for house beats and some daring, if somewhat mixed, vocal takes”.

Lil Yachty Tell His Concrete Boys Crew ‘Let’s Get On Dey Ass’ With An Electrifying New Video
Earlier this year, Lil Yachty launched his record label, Concrete Rekordz , and signed his first act: The raucous, Atlanta-based crew Concrete Boys, which includes a collection of proteges Yachty believes can get hip-hop out of the “ terrible state ” he fretted over last year. To that end, he’s been releasing a slew of off-the-wall, free verse-style singles, including “ A Cold Sunday ,” “ Something Ether ,” and now, “Let’s Get On Dey Ass,” an electrifying track in the vein of fellow ATLien Playboi Carti’s amorphous, video gamey sound.
In the colorful video for the song, Yachty and the Boys (and Karrahbooo — I guess it’s like a “Storm from the X-Men” situation) vibe out and parade through a series of sparse tableaux sporting matching gear to show off their team spirit. They also demonstrate an astonishing array of complex high-fives, careen through the Georgia woods in a luxury SUV, and peruse racks of vacuum sealed fashion pieces. The vibe just screams good times and camaraderie, and suggests more boisterous and defiant hits to come.
Yachty isn’t just trying to save hip-hop, though; last month, he also teamed up with UK producer James Blake for an experimental collaborative album called Bad Cameo .
